Transaction 22fa38526bcb80b7ee428c911ee5abe812964631fdfae79cea720e5918051650

1 Input
2 Outputs
  • 22fa38526bcb80b7ee428c911ee5abe812964631fdfae79cea720e5918051650:0
  • value  338289
    address  1G38jbfKTwaYbaRSJVZK7yLGsyw8m3LiXY
  • 22fa38526bcb80b7ee428c911ee5abe812964631fdfae79cea720e5918051650:1
  • value  4385826
    address  1Benw3wfZnRDrCZQdfdxQci83SKwHb8W6f